From e4003d2986066d68e026228cf83819d8fe1fb426 Mon Sep 17 00:00:00 2001
From: Yoann Dufresne <yoann.dufresne0@gmail.com>
Date: Wed, 19 Feb 2020 13:52:48 +0100
Subject: [PATCH] debug cluster on dict key missing

---
 deconvolution/dgraph/CliqueDGFactory.py | 4 ++++
 1 file changed, 4 insertions(+)

diff --git a/deconvolution/dgraph/CliqueDGFactory.py b/deconvolution/dgraph/CliqueDGFactory.py
index c98bccc..ddbf0e9 100644
--- a/deconvolution/dgraph/CliqueDGFactory.py
+++ b/deconvolution/dgraph/CliqueDGFactory.py
@@ -37,6 +37,10 @@ class CliqueDGFactory(AbstractDGFactory):
                 neighbors = list(subgraph.neighbors(node))
                 # Looks into the neighbors for clique pairing
                 for nei in neighbors:
+                    if nei not in clq_per_node:
+                        print("!!!!!!!!!!!!!!!")
+                        print(clq_per_node)
+                        print("!!!!!!!!!!!!!!!")
                     nei_clqs = clq_per_node[nei]
                     # Pair useful cliques
                     for nei_clq in nei_clqs:
-- 
GitLab